Information and Technology - Software Engineer III
Listed on 2026-05-28
-
Software Development
Software Engineer, C# / Unity Developer
Job Description
Job Title:
Software Engineer III
Duration: 6 Months Contract
Location:
Hillsboro, OR 97124
Shift: M-F 8am-5pm, Temp to hire for right fit (Good attendance, performance, attitude, budget, etc
- No guarantees but what Manager is hoping to see in a candidate).
Pay Rate: $45.00 - $58.00 Hourly.
Job Description
Location/Division Specific Information:
This on-site position is located at our Fort Collins, CO which is home to our Cell Sorting Instrumentation center of excellence. We have an enthusiastic and hard‑working team which is committed to providing scientists with groundbreaking and high-quality instrumentation. We pride ourselves on delivering amazing results and value our outstanding culture.
Your Impact:
The Software Engineer III is part of a multi‑functional engineering team designing software and instrumentation to aid in groundbreaking high‑speed cellular research! You will work closely with the hardware engineering and application teams to develop and define the instruments and the controlling software.
What will you do?
You will assist in the development of new applications for our Instrument suite; participate and collaborate in product development for existing and new products; and support manufacturing through product testing.
- Perform all phases of software development including design, implementation, testing, integration, and maintenance of software.
- Development and support of GUI, analysis, communications, and instrument control software.
- Collaborate with verification and validation teams to build test requirements based on system software requirements and design.
How will you get here?
Education:
- BS degree and 5+ years of experience or MS degree and 3+ years of experience or PhD
- Experience:
- 3+ years working with C#
- 3+ years working with UWP, or WPF
- 3+ years of experience with .NET, .NET Core or .Net 6-8
- 3+ years of experience developing C++ or C# GUI applications using object‑oriented techniques and methodology.
- Design Patterns experience with MVVM
- Experience with multi‑threaded constructs
- Enhancing and improving existing libraries and applications understanding and communicating associated risks.
- Deep understanding and experience in API design (using RESTFul), including versioning, isolation, documentation for internal and external (commercial)
- Proven experience with software development life cycle (SDLC) and agile/iterative methodologies
- Understanding of Object‑Oriented Design Patterns
- Comfortable working in Visual Studio and Azure Dev Ops
Preferred Experience:
- XAML Skills, whether on UWP, or WPF
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).